Sera and Vaccines
Price Range: Negotiable
Categories: Sera and Vaccines
Business Type: Manufacturer
Price Range: Negotiable
Categories: Sera and Vaccines
Business Type: Manufacturer
Price Range: Negotiable
Categories: Sera and Vaccines
Business Type: Manufacturer
Price Range: Negotiable
Categories: Sera and Vaccines
Business Type: Manufacturer
Price Range: Negotiable
Categories: Sera and Vaccines
Business Type: Manufacturer
Price Range: Negotiable
Categories: Sera and Vaccines
Business Type: Manufacturer
Price Range: Negotiable
Categories: Sera and Vaccines
Business Type: Manufacturer
Price Range: Negotiable
Categories: Sera and Vaccines
Business Type: Manufacturer
Price Range: Negotiable
Categories: Sera and Vaccines
Business Type: Manufacturer
More
Others
Price Range: Negotiable
Categories: Bio Products
Price Range: Negotiable
Categories: Bio Products
Price Range: Negotiable
Categories: Bio Products
Price Range: Negotiable
Categories: Bio Products
Price Range: Negotiable
Categories: Bio Products
Price Range: Negotiable
Categories: Bio Products
Price Range: Negotiable
Categories: Bio Products
Categories: Bio Products
Categories: Bio Products
More
Contact Us
Tel: (+86) 400 610 1188
WhatsApp/Telegram/Wechat: +86 13621645194
Follow Us: